Description
This training provides an overview of trauma-informed care, emphasizing its core principles and the neurobiology of trauma. Participants will learn how to recognize trauma responses, implement supportive practices, and resist re-traumatization in patients, caregivers, and staff.
Target Audience
Healthcare providers, support staff, and administrators involved in patient care and workplace wellness.
Learning Outcomes
After completing this training, you will be able to:
- Identify at least three trauma responses, including the fight, flight, and freeze responses.
- Describe the six principles of trauma-informed care and their application in healthcare settings.
- Develop strategies to recognize and manage trauma responses in patients, caregivers, and staff.
- Implement techniques to resist re-traumatization while supporting emotional and physical safety.
